Fidelity National Financial, Inc., is an American provider of title insurance and settlement services to the real estate and mortgage industries. A Fortune 500 company, Fidelity National Financial generated approximately $8.469 billion in annual revenue in 2019 from its title and real estate-related operations. The company was the first instance of an attorney licensed by a Native American Tribe being certified as "authorized house counsel" in the state of Florida.
Westrock Coffee Co is a global integrated coffee, tea and functional beverage solutions provider. It sources, roasts, manufactures and distributes coffee products, ready-to-drink beverages and custom formulations for retail, foodservice and commercial clients across North America and other key markets.
